How Reddit Conversion Tracking Works for Shopify
Reddit conversion tracking operates through a pixel or API integration that monitors user actions after they click your ad. When a visitor lands on your Shopify store, the tracking system records their journey from the initial ad click through to completed purchases, sign-ups, or other valuable events.
The setup process involves generating a conversion tracking pixel within your Reddit Ads Manager account, then installing that pixel code on your Shopify store. Many merchants opt for server-side tracking to bypass ad blockers and browser restrictions, ensuring more accurate data collection. This approach captures conversions even when third-party cookies are blocked, which is increasingly common in modern browsers.
Key Events to Track for Shopify Stores
The most critical conversion events for Shopify stores include:
- Purchase completions – The ultimate measure of advertising ROI
- Add to cart actions – Indicates strong purchase intent
- Initiated checkouts – Shows users moving through the funnel
- View content events – Measures product page engagement
- Sign-ups or registrations – Valuable for building email lists
Each event provides different insights into customer behavior, allowing you to optimize campaigns at every stage of the buying journey.
Setting Up Reddit Conversion Tracking on Shopify
The technical implementation requires careful attention to detail. Begin by logging into Reddit Ads Manager and navigating to the conversion tracking section. Reddit provides a JavaScript pixel code that you must embed into your Shopify theme.
For Shopify users, the simplest method involves using a tag management system or a dedicated app that handles pixel installation automatically. Many merchants prefer using Google Tag Manager to centralize all tracking codes, including the Reddit pixel, because it allows for easier updates without modifying theme files directly.
After installation, test your pixel using Reddit’s built-in verification tool. This step confirms that events fire correctly when users perform actions on your store. Without proper testing, you risk collecting incomplete or inaccurate data that undermines your campaign optimization efforts.
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them
One frequent mistake involves placing the pixel on every page but forgetting to fire specific event codes on conversion pages. For instance, the purchase event must trigger only on the order confirmation page, not the cart page. Another issue arises when using accelerated mobile pages (AMP) without adjusting pixel code accordingly.
From a developer’s perspective, the most reliable approach involves implementing server-side tracking through Reddit’s Conversions API. This method sends event data directly from your Shopify backend to Reddit’s servers, bypassing potential client-side issues like ad blockers or network failures. According to Reddit’s official documentation, server-side tracking typically captures 15-30% more conversions than pixel-only implementations.

Advanced Attribution Models for Deeper Insights
Standard last-click attribution often undervalues Reddit’s role in the customer journey. A user might discover your brand through a Reddit post, leave without purchasing, then return days later via a Google search to complete the sale. Without proper attribution, you might credit Google for a conversion that Reddit initiated.
Consider implementing view-through attribution windows of 24 to 48 hours for Reddit campaigns. This accounts for users who see your ad, don’t click immediately, but later visit your store directly. Multi-touch attribution models provide even more nuanced understanding of how Reddit interacts with other marketing channels.
